"Lake City’s neighborhood ice cream shop makes its own base — from locally sourced milk — and is distinguished by some standout seasonal flavors (carrot cake, dairy-free huckleberry), toppings (house-made toasted marshmallows and sprinkles), and the presence of the shop basset hound, Lil’ Tiger, for whom the operation is named. Canines eat for free here." - Sophie Grossman, Eater Staff
